Rodriguez open to any title challenge after latest win

Aaron Clarke
Lightweight & Featherweight Writer ·

Jesse Rodriguez says he will take on all comers in the flyweight/" class="internal-link text-bone underline decoration-ash/30 hover:decoration-gold underline-offset-2">light flyweight division. The champion told BBC Sport he is ready to face any opponent put in front of him.

“I'm ready for whoever, whenever. Put them in front of me, and I'm going to say yes.”

— Jesse Rodriguez, via BBC Sport

What Jesse Rodriguez said

Rodriguez holds a world title at flyweight/" class="internal-link text-bone underline decoration-ash/30 hover:decoration-gold underline-offset-2">light flyweight and has been linked with a number of potential challengers in recent months. The division remains competitive, with several fighters calling for a shot at his belt. Rodriguez's willingness to face anyone keeps the door open for multiple fight options.

What it moves

The statement puts pressure on promoters to deliver a credible opponent for Rodriguez's next defence. His broad acceptance could fast-track negotiations with top contenders. The champion's camp will now wait for offers from rival title-holders or sanctioning-body mandatories.
